OK Burger, Yeouido

Yeouido might be known for having the (formerly) tallest building in Korea, the National Legislature, and cherry blossoms, but not for the outstanding food. However, legislators and businesspeople have to eat too. On June 25, some friends and I found our way over to the surprisingly satisfying OK Burger in Yeouido.

The restaurant is actually in the basement of a building near to the IFC Mall. I would be lying if I did not mention that I was a bit skeptical. My significant other, Ms. R, and my friend, Ms. S, also seemed to be doubting my pick. I am glad to have proved them wrong! Rather than being dim and grimy, the restaurant’s interior was bright and clean.

Ms. S ordered the Mexican Burger and Ms. R ordered the BBQ Burger. I ordered the namesake OK Burger. We all split a side of onion rings, as well. We did not have to wait for long, as the food arrived shortly.

These are not small burgers. They are stacked to the brim with meat, toppings, and condiments. In fact, Ms. S’s burger came complete with a deep-friend hot pepper inside of it. I had to use a fork and a knife to eat mine. Ms. S made fun of me.

All three of us were amazed at how good the burgers tasted. Ms. S and I, both U.S. citizens, agreed that these were the best burgers we had eaten since moving to South Korea. The patty itself tasted fresh and its consistency was solid, but not rubbery. It was an amazing balance.

The onion rings came out midway through the meal. Just as one should not serve the best wine last, they should have been served before the burgers arrived. The onion rings were comparatively lackluster, but still tasty. The onion rings themselves were especially thick and crunchy.

Honestly, OK Burger in Yeouido is worth making a trip across the city for. The service was efficient, perhaps because you order and pay before receiving your food. The location might be a bit tricky to find, but it is worth it. To reiterate – this is the best burger I’ve had in Korea. I cannot recommend this highly enough.
